My first rented house

When we got married, we stayed in the shop for a few years before we shifted to our first rented house. That house belonged to an old lady who stayed on the other part of the whole house with his handicapped son. The house was specially built for her late mother. Soon her mother passed away and she let it out for rental.

I happened to know about the rental and I planned to shift in as soon as possible. I didn't know anything about the former occupant. I was just too happy to have found a new place to stay.

Day by day, I shifted in my stuff from my place at the shop. I always used the back door as my room was located at the back portion of the second shop. Finally, only left the furniture that were to be shifted. I chose a convenient Sunday as my husband was not working. However, the day was still in the seventh month of the Chinese calender.

When I shifted in, I didn't even set up any altar for the god/goddess.
My eldest girl was four years and I brought back my second girl who was two years old from Taiping as she was taken care by my aunt. My mum came to stay with me and took care of them. A year later I gave birth to my third girl. I employed a maid to help my mum. I taught her how to cook and mix milk for my kids. 

I showed her how to mix the milk and she seemed to follow my instructions. But once I caught her unexpectedly whereby she didn't follow my instruction. She actually poured hot water onto the milk powder. But she didn't stay long as she ran away with someone.

During our stay in this house, my second girl always cried when she got up from bed. My youngest girl would cry just after midnight. Something weird was going around the house. My mum injured her ankle and I had an accident right in front of my house. 

So I looked around for another rented place and found one. Coincidentally, my landlady wanted back the house. So this time we shifted but I had chosen a good day.

Few years ago, my eldest girl related her story about the house. It seemed to be haunted. She actually saw something in white flying passed her room. She could only stare as she didn't know what it was..

We stayed in that house for three years..

Moral of the story: Don't shift in the seventh month of the Chinese calender.
